Congratulations to you for the achievement of implementing GNU Health
in 7 public hospitals ! 

The upgrade process is documented on the Wikibook [1]. Of course, that
covers just the basics. If you have made local modules, you have to
make sure they are compatible the latest GNU Health and Tryton version.
